    I would unreservedly recommend Burford Equine Rehoming Centre.
    From the enquiry stage at the beginning, the visit to the centre to meet my chosen pony, to the paperwork and information required from me to them and vice versa, to the collection of my pony - the whole team were professional and understanding, helpful throughout the whole process.
    I appreciate the 'after support' that is in place should I need it from the centre and my appointed regional contact.
    I personally believe in offering a second (or however many) chance to any animal who finds themselves for whatever reason in a rescue/rehoming situation. (I currently have 5 such animals!) .Thank you Blue Cross for such a positive experience.

    The staff at Burford Rehoming Centre made the process so easy. I was called within 20 mins of submitting my application and after a short but thorough interview I was invited to reserve the rats. On the day I collected them, the staff were understandably a little flustered as there was a dog giving birth and camera crews filming around the centre! However, I was seen very quickly and the rats' medical background, ongoing care and other bits were brilliantly explained to me. They knew I'd owned rats before so they knew that I knew what I was doing, so they weren't at all patronising and simply ensured I was up to speed with what these particular rats needed. I wouldn't hesitate to recommend Burford Rehoming Centre and will definitely adopt from there again in the future.

Blue Cross Burford Rehoming Centre

Busy rehoming centre (and headquarters for the national charity) caring for horses, dogs, cats, rabbits, guinea pigs and other small animals looking for loving new homes. Opening hours: 11.00am – 3.45, Monday, Tuesday and Thursday to Sunday. Closed on Wednesdays. Tuesday and Thursday open until 7pm for appointments only. Please note: The stables are not open to the public so to avoid disappointment please call ahead to make an appointment.
